D3D9 Samples(10)--Text3D
打开Text3D项目。先编译运行下项目,看看效果:
这个例子演示各种字体的绘制,包括2D文字和3D立体文字。
1. 基本绘制
ID3DXFont* g_pStatsFont =NULL;
绘制上方黄色的两行字,显示:
在OnCreateDevice中创建字体D3DXCreateFont。
在OnResetDevice、OnLostDevice、OnDestroyDevice中响应Device状态的变化。
在OnFrameRender中绘制:
SetRect( &rc, 2, 0, 0, 0 );
g_pStatsFont->Dr